Home Foundation Leveling in Camden County, NJ
Home foundation le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a property's foundation to correct uneven or settling conditions. These projects typically address issues such as cracks in walls,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Homeowners often seek foundation leveling to preserve the structural integrity of their property, prevent further damage, and improve safety. Before requesting this service,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the settlement, the underlying causes, and the methods used to level the foundation effectively.
The scope of foundation leveling can include various techniques like mudjacking, piering, or slab stabilization, depending on the specific needs of the property. It is important for property owners to know whether their foundation issues are caused by soil movement, moisture changes, or other factors, and to consider how the chosen method will impact their home long-term. Clarifying these details can help homeowners make informed decisions and ensure the stability and safety of their property after the work is completed.

Common Home Foundation Leveling Jobs
Foundation leveling involves adjusting and stabilizing a home's foundation to prevent uneven settling.
Slab jacking lifts and restores sunken concrete slabs to improve stability and appearance.
Pier and beam foundation repair addresses issues with support piers to ensure proper load distribution.
Wall stabilization corrects cracks and shifts caused by foundation movement to maintain structural integrity.
Settlement correction remedies uneven ground beneath the foundation to prevent future shifting.
Structural assessment services evaluate foundation conditions to determine necessary repairs and stabilization options.
Home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es uneven foundation settling? Foundation settling can result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ction, leading to uneven support for the structure.
How do foundation leveling services work? These services typically involve lifting and stabilizing the foundation to restore proper alignment and prevent further movement.
What signs indicate a need for foundation leveling? Sign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and gaps around windows or doors.
Is foundation leveling suitable for all types of structures? It is commonly used for residential and commercial buildings experiencing uneven settling or shifting issues.
